Argos

Argos is a UK retailer that provides a broad assortment of general merchandise through its store and online networks. Customers can shop online, using mobile channels, online shopping stores in london at 850 stores, or over the phone. The company also provides home delivery as well as click and collect services.

Argos is one of the most well-known catalog retailers. Traditionally, the process of shopping consisted of filling out a tiny order form that contained the catalogue numbers of the desired items. Customers were given pencils in red (formerly blue ones) in the shops for this purpose. The forms were then taken to the counter and paid for. A receipt was issued indicating where to wait for the goods to be collected from the storeroom.

The company has earned a reputation for its innovative and shopper-centric designs. In recent years it has expanded its digital channels, launched an app for mobiles, as well as a variety of smart appliances.

Debenhams

The first Debenhams store opened in 1778 on Wigmore Street in London's West End. The company grew and opened new stores across the UK. The company has changed its name several times, most recently changing from Clark & Debenhams to Debenhams and Freebody.

After the war, the business expanded quickly. In 1920, Harvey Nichols, a Knightsbridge retailer, was bought by Debenhams. While operating under the Debenhams brand, stores were independent. However the purchasing and warehouse operations were centralized.

In 1985 the Burton Group acquired the brand. Later, Arcadia merged with it. In 1998, the retailer resigned from the Burton Group to return to the stock market. In the late nineties, Belinda Earl was appointed chief executive and introduced exclusive designer clothes under the Designers at Debenhams label. The company also launched its first store outside London in Cheltenham.

John Lewis

The John Lewis Partnership is a British department store chain that has 52 stores. Including the flagship Oxford Street store and the Peter Jones branch in Sloane Square, London, 35 of these are traditional department stores, and 12 are "John Lewis at Home' furniture and homeware outlets. The partnership runs two Food Halls and also Waitrose own-brand products in its shops.

In 1933, John Lewis purchased its first store outside of London. It was a Jessops in Nottingham. In the 1940s, the partnership expanded by buying Selfridge's Provincial Stores. This was a collection of suburban and province department stores.

House of Fraser

House of Fraser is the most well-known department store in the United Kingdom. It sells branded clothes and homeware, and has branches in many cities. It was acquired in 2018 by Sports Direct founder Mike Ashley However, the company faces several challenges.

One of them is Brexit which has caused economic uncertainty and reduced consumer spending. It's difficult to compete against online retailers. The company's sales have been impacted by higher shipping costs and fluctuations in the currency.

The famous 318 Oxford Street branch was earmarked for closure in the year 2018, but it was saved by Sports Direct owner Mike Ashley. The new owners are planning to transform the Art Deco-style building into an office and shops, as well as a rooftop dining area. HoF's parent company, Fraser Group, blames the outdated business rates for its woes and warns that more closures are inevitable if the system isn't changed.

AO

AO is one of the largest businesses to emerge from the North West over the past two decades. The Bolton-based firm, which was founded by John Roberts, is listed on the London Stock Exchange and specialises in electronic and white goods. The company, initially called Appliances Online, was established after Roberts won PS1 on a bet with a buddy that he would change the method of buying white appliances online. Since since then, AO Business, AO Finance, and AO Mobile have been added to the company. It also boasts a delivery service and an recycling plant for fridges.
